๐ About the Film
Children in the Fire tells the deeply moving stories of Ukrainian children whose lives have been irrevocably changed by war. Through a powerful combination of real footage and animation, the film presents war as seen through childrenโs eyes โ their fears, losses, and extraordinary resilience.
Director Evgeny Afineevsky emphasizes that the film was created to ensure the world truly hears childrenโs voices, not just statistics or headlines. By drawing the audience into a childโs perspective, the film invites empathy, understanding, and moral responsibility. It is a story not only about trauma, but also about hope, courage, and the unbreakable human spirit. Children in the Fire asks us not to look away, but to witness, remember, and act.
